Learning Objectives

  • Understand how plants grow and what factors affect their growth
  • Learn about photosynthesis as the food-making process in plants
  • Identify the role of leaves as 'food factories' of plants
  • Understand the importance of chlorophyll, sunlight, water, and carbon dioxide in photosynthesis
  • Learn how plants transport water, minerals, and food through their body
